Tengo el siguiente código en un botón ...
Código HTML:
<input type="submit" class="boton" onclick="comprobar('eventosproci.php')" value="Publicar" />
¿Quién puede ayudarme?
Gracias
| |||
No se usa el confirm ... Saludos. Tengo el siguiente código en un botón ... Código HTML: <input type="submit" class="boton" onclick="comprobar('eventosproci.php')" value="Publicar" /> ¿Quién puede ayudarme? Gracias |
| |||
Re: No se usa el confirm ... Gracias, pero creo que no me he explicado. Necesito que cuando el usuario "Acepte" el confirm ... se ejecute la funcion comprobar .... Si pulsa "Cancelar" que o se ejecute... Sería como poner un if(confirm("Pregunta?")->SI->ejecutar)) Gracias |
| |||
Re: No se usa el confirm ... Gracias... lo probaré en cuanto pueda. ¿Eso lo puedo poner justo detras del onclick?¿no? <input type="submit" class="boton" onclick="if(confirm("Pregunta?")) comprobar('eventosproci.php')" value="Publicar" /> Gracias |
| ||||
Re: No se usa el confirm ... Hola: No te olvides que estás usando un botón del tipo submit, y que inmediatamente se realice la comprobación se va a enviar el formulario (porque supongo que se tratará de un formulario... ), sea el resultado que sea el que devuelva esa comprobación si no usas la palabra return (very important!) Saludos
__________________ Por favor: No hagan preguntas de temas de foros en mensajes privados... no las respondo |
| |||
Re: No se usa el confirm ... Cierto ... ¿Y si fuera un type=button, y la accion submit la hiciera en la funcion que llamo? ¿podría ponerlo ... <input type="button" class="boton" onclick="if(confirm("Pregunta?")) comprobar('eventosproci.php')" value="Publicar" /> ...asi? Gracias |
| ||||
Re: No se usa el confirm ... Cita: Aunque en teoría es posible tu idea, ese tipo de formularios se considera inaccesible, ya que quien tenga javascript desactivado, jamás enviará el formulario.Mi consejo es validar tanto en el navegador del usuario con javascript, como con algún lenguaje del servidor (y la validación del servidor como más importante) Saludos
__________________ Por favor: No hagan preguntas de temas de foros en mensajes privados... no las respondo |
| ||||
Re: No se usa el confirm ... Yo estoy con caricatos, eso deberias ponerlo en el evento onSubmit Código HTML: <form name="formu" method="post" onsubmit="return comprueba();"> <input type="text" name="campo"> <input type="submit" value="enviar"> </form> <script type="text/javascript"> <!-- function comprueba() { if (confirm('Esta seguro?')) return true; return false; } --> </script> |